For the 2025 Super Bowl on Feb. 9 at Caesars Superdome, Jay-Z enjoyed a father-daughter outing with his and Beyoncé's daughters Blue Ivy Carter and Rumi Carter.

Here’s a public service announcement: Jay-ZBlue Ivy Carter, and Rumi Carter are in the building. 

Exactly one week after some of the family, including Beyoncé, enjoyed a family night out at the 2025 Grammys—where the “Texas Hold ‘Em” singer scooped up three trophies including one for Album of the Year—Jay-Z, Rumi and Blue IVy made a splash at the big game in New Orleans Feb. 9, arriving to watch the Kansas City Chiefs take on the Philadelphia Eagles. ICYMI, the “99 Problems” rapper—who also shares Rumi's 7-year-old twin Sir with the Dreamgirls alum—attended the annual show alongside the couple’s oldest child in support of Bey. While there, the singer made history becoming the first Black woman to win Album of the Year for Cowboy Carter in the 21st century.

"I just feel very full and very honored," she said onstage at Los Angeles' Crypto.com Arena on Feb. 2. "It's been many, many years. I just want to thank the Grammys, every songwriter, every collaborator, every producer, all of the hard work."

But that wasn’t the only moment that the “Formation” singer graced the stage, of course, as she also won Best Country album, too—an achievement that left Beyoncé so stunned that not only did she become a meme, but Blue Ivy herself gently signaled to her mom that was time to stand up and accept her trophy.

"I'd like to thank all of the incredible country artists that accepted this album," Beyoncé said in her acceptance speech of her album released in March 2024. "We worked so hard on it. I think sometimes genre is a code word to keep us in our place as artists. And I just want to encourage people to do what they're passionate about, and to say, 'Stay persistent.'"
